Transaction 3d61eeb9ffe801b566cc2b2d925237a91bdc4b573edc3c324c49f51751421268
1 Input
1 Output
-
3d61eeb9ffe801b566cc2b2d925237a91bdc4b573edc3c324c49f51751421268:0
- value
- 378900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b7d5c9b7ef759933fbe6250dcecde91db8a9d93 OP_EQUAL
- address
- 3EQa2Vfp49mLJwqQ3vmubrpdSi83XQ12wi